Entrez Gene
Summary This pseudogene is located downstream from the growth hormone locus on chromosome 17. This locus evolved by a series of partial duplications that have disrupted the human gene. A homologous gene in mouse encodes a testis-specific cell adhesion protein that may play a role in germ cell-Sertoli cell interactions. [provided by RefSeq, Apr 2012]
